Guest Allergies

If you’re going to have guests, think of the allergies that they could have. The reality is that anything can cause allergies. Do you have pets? Those can cause allergies. It doesn’t have to be just cats and dogs. Birds can cause allergies. The ideal situation is to remove the pets completely, but the reality is that is not always possible or desirable. The next best thing is to clean completely and sterilize the areas right before guests arrive.

Mold can be everywhere. It’s not just in the bathroom and the fridge. It can be found on the wall behind the sink or under the bathroom sink. When you clean for the get together, you want to clean everywhere. Clean above the refrigerator. Clean under the sink. Clean the inside of the cabinets. Clean the walls. Look behind things and between them. Scrub it completely.

Dust should be addressed the same as the mold. It lands everywhere. The more you live in a place, the more you ignore stuff. You get used to things such as dust on the windowsill. It is unattractive, dirty, and irritates allergies.

Cleaning Supplies

Take your cleaning to a whole new level by using more green friendly cleaning supplies. There are many commercial ones that claim to be green and healthy for your home. Read these carefully. Not all are what they claim to be. The safest way to go is to use baking soda, vinegar, lemon juice, and bleach. Not all at the same time, mind you, but they are some of your most powerful and healthy cleaning agents.

Clean Air

You may clean and you may dust extremely well, but the very air you breathe could be hazardous to your health. Those pets still produce hair and dandruff. The mold is trying to find a new home. The dust is ever present. You need to get your air clean.

Good air purifiers help get rooms clean and the air breathable. Adding extra plants help keep the air pure. If the weather is nice, open up the windows and allow fresh air in.

If you need to light candles or use potpourri, use light fresh scents. Heavy scents can cause allergies. Many are allergic to eucalyptus which is used in many floral and scent pieces. Try to use more natural scents such as vanilla, apply, or light floral. You never want the smell to be over-powering.
